October 2008
HP Pavilion dv5 (Core 2 Duo P8400 Processor 2.26GHz, 2GB RAM) Video: HP Pavilion dv5 review
By Darius Chang
Review summary: Despite its affordable price point, the HP Pavilion dv5 offers a full range of multimedia features as well as a distinct design.
Pros: Strong graphics performance ; distinctive HP Imprint design ; USB/eSATA combo port ; feature-packed with fingerprint sensor and multimedia functionality ; Blu-ray combo drive
Cons: Runs hot ; display is not in 16:9 aspect ratio and does not have full-HD resolution option ; poor battery life ; glossy keyboard and touchpad ; no subwoofer
Verdict: For portable entertainment on a budget, the HP Pavilion dv5 offers a strong feature suite like a Blu-ray combo drive and fast graphics performance while remaining affordable.
